My husband, two boys (7&10), 10lb dog and myself LOVED everything about this property! We were hesitant to book at first because most of the activities that interested us were on the west side of town closer to Banner Elk but we kept coming back to Nature's Call listing because it looked perfect for us and it was! The downstairs game room/den was so much fun, as was the hot tub, fire pit, big swing out front, creek in the back. The wrap around porch was great with plenty of rockers, swings, large table, hot tub and grill. We had a blast snow tubing @ Hawksnest, Wilderness Alpine Coaster, Grandfather Mt. Suspension Bridge, and hikes at Moses Cone & Julian Price Memorial Lake. We ordered delivery from Bella's our first night but our fave meals were at Lost Province in Downtown Boone and Banner Elk Cafe. The coolest place we went was "Avante Garden Home" between Hawksnest & Sugar Mt - craft beers, local wines, snacks, make smores at your own fire pit while sitting on swings and feeding free roaming turkeys and chickens. No real cons about property just observations: the stairs down to basement and incline to back creek are pretty steep, the porch is enclosed with gates but we were worried our little dog might try to sneak out the bottom unattended. Cabin is right off a road you rarely heard/saw cars but there is no neighborhood or side area to really walk a dog. Ours got enough exercise just around the property so it wasn't an issue. The front yard is not somewhere you wouldn't kick/throw a ball, uneven surface with wildlife droppings but kids didn't mind because they loved the swing so much. Well stocked kitchen +some essentials like left over saran, tea, oils, coffee filters, fire starters, starter TP, paper towels,soaps,shamp/cond. Dimly lit upstairs but the heat worked great for both upstairs and basement-important for us Floridians : ) Bunks were not made up but we found linens downstairs -which is listed in info binder but we didn't get to read it until after scrambling to get kids to bed. We drove an average of 30-40minutes each way for most of our outings but it wasn't an issue. We have travelled to many places and this is definitely one of our favorite rentals!
